Plans

StockPilot pricing tiers.

Starter

$29/month

  • Up to 500 variants
  • 1 scan per day
  • Stockout risk alerts
  • Basic slow-moving risk
  • Up to 3 alert rules

Growth

$59/month

  • Up to 5,000 variants
  • Reorder suggestions
  • CSV export
  • Up to 20 alert rules
  • Multiple scans per day

Scale

$119/month

  • Up to 20,000 variants
  • 12 scans per day
  • Multi-location view
  • Advanced filters
  • Up to 100 alert rules

What is StockPilot on Shopify?
StockPilot is a Shopify app in the Inventory optimization category. StockPilot helps Shopify merchants spot inventory problems before they affect sales. It turns product and inventory data into clear risk signals for stockouts, slow-moving items, and overstock, then helps teams review what needs attention and export reorder suggestions. The app creates a simple daily inventory workflow inside Shopify Admin without automatically changing store inventory.

Methodology

Where the numbers come from.

Ratings, review counts, pricing tiers, “Built for Shopify”, launch date, and category memberships come from the live Shopify App Store listing — refreshed daily by Ongoing.AI’s crawler. The review-count trajectory is the diff between today’s snapshot and snapshots from 7 and 28 days ago. Topic counts and sentiment come from the review corpus, topic-tagged with Claude. Install footprint is observed via Ongoing.AI’s tech-detection pass against actively-tracked Shopify storefronts. Catalog position is computed at snapshot time against every active app sharing the primary category. Snapshot generated .
